Larkin Collins 1810–1847 – Genealogical Records

Birth Date: 1810

Birth Location: North Carolina, United States

Death Date: 1847

Death Location: Letcher, Letcher, Kentucky, United States

Father: Thomas Collins

Mother: Nancy Williams

Spouse(s): Cynthia Williams

Children(s): Finley Collins, Mary Collins, Cynthia Williams, Watson Collins, Sarah Collins, Sanders Collins

The story of Larkin Collins began in 1810 in North Carolina, United States. Larkin Collins married Cynthia Williams, and had children including Cynthia Williams, Finley Collins, Mary Jane Collins, Sanders Collins, Sarah Collins, Watson Collins. Larkin Collins passed away in 1847 in Letcher, Letcher, Kentucky, United States.
